Captain Jack | 12/03/2016

Photon solar and battery system.

It was scary! The thermometer in the car said -14. I was one half of a mile from home, just shy of the intersection around the corner from home. A buggy was stuck in the drift. I parked the car in a bare spot and helped push the buggy free. The wind was howling, my hands felt like ice under the ski gloves. Back in the car, now -15, I managed to turn the car around in the bare spot and proceeded to go back, hoping the intersection a mile east would not be drifted shut. The drifts on the next road were bad, but passable, barely. It was almost dark and 16 below. I made it home and loaded my outdoor wood boiler in coveralls, literally crawling through a snow drift, dragging wood with me. Seventeen below and the wind continued to howl. It was twenty below at midnight when the power went out! As a single man I would not be too scared, but I had a wife, 3 kids, and at the time, a new baby on the way! Also, the thought of our new wood boiler freezing up was a nightmare. The house was losing temperature fast, but fortunately, our REMC had the power restored within two hours, which is amazing in such dangerous conditions. I made a decision that night. We needed a backup plan. After saving up some money, I talked to the gentlemen at Photon Electric. I told them, in the event of a power outage, I want enough backup power to run the boiler, the furnace fan, and to flush the toilets. I have to say, I was quite impressed with the efficiency of their work as well as the product. A week after the installation, our power company alerted us regarding a two hour power outage for the maintenance to the neighborhood lines, to take place at 9 the next morning. Next day, working on the computer, I asked the wife if it was 9 yet. She said 5 after. Was the power out? Yes, but we could not tell, the computer screen never even blinked! One other thing I asked of Photon Electric, was that during normal days without a power outage, how do we harness the “juice” the panels take in. It’s called “back-feeding.” All extra power goes to the grid, to be stored for later use. The result? Our electric bill went from $116 to $72. But to work this out not only requires the expertise with the equipment, but also knowledge of local codes, which differ amongst counties as well. This was too big of an investment to trust to beginners, and I am very glad I chose Photon Electric. At the writing of this testimonial, Wayne & Henry have a combined experience of 16 years, and it shows! * Update 12-3-2016. I wrote this testimonial a year ago, and am still enjoying the peace of mind. To do it over, I would not change a thing!

Jon Stibal | 12/07/2010

Home Energy LLC installed a 4.7KW expansion to an existing 1.8KW PV system on our home in 2010. They were extremely knowledgable and helpful about the Outback equipment we already had and what options were available for expansion. They were prompt in getting us an estimate, responding to questions or communications, and with completing the work itself. They handled all the permits and arrangements with our power company (unlike our previous installer), and getting us registered with SRECTrade to generate and sell SRECs for the power we generate. Having built a home in 2006 and dealt with a different company that year to do our original PV install, trying for 2-3 months in 2010 to get even a bid or cost estimate for this expansion from two other renewable enegry companies, I can say that Home Energy LLC is the best company I`ve dealt with for PV systems (and probably the best and easiest contractor overall I`ve had the pleasure to work with). I would recommend them without hesitation, and they will definitely be the first company I call if/when we decide to expand our renewable energy system, whether it be PV, wind or a solar hot water system. The only incentive available to us are the federal tax credits, which will be handled by me when I file my taxes. I did confirm with Home Energy LLC that the equipment I was purchasing should be eligible for the credits (although I understand that they are not attorneys or IRS agents, and cannot make guarantees about my getting the tax credits).

Gordon Moore, McCormick Motors | 10/12/2009

Great people and a great company. They guided me every step of the way and I am very satisfied with the production of the system. Most importantly they did not oversell the system and it is operating at a rate 40% higher than anticipated. The energy gran we applied for was essential to the completion of the project. My contractor provided the technical assistance I needed to complete the application. Pricing continues to be a major issue. The costs for these systems needs to get down to a 15 year pay off to be economically viable. The grant coupled with the federal tax credit allow me to reach that mark. Without a grant then the projects become very problematic with just a tax credit given the current price structure and incentives from our local electric supplier.
